Mid-Day Report

Stronger than expected growth in the third quarter lifted the markets higher during the midday with the Dow climbing 56 points to 13,848. Nasdaq soared 20 points to 2837.

On the upside

First Consulting Group (Nasdaq: FCGI) agreed to be acquired by Computer Sciences for approximately $352.3 million.

Strong sales growth lifted second quarter earnings higher for McKesson (NYSE: MCK) to beat expectations.

Newmont Mining (NYSE: NEM) reported third quarter earnings that doubled due to one time gains.

On the downside

Although Buffalo Wild Wings (Nasdaq: BWLD) reported higher third quarter earnings, the results fell short of expectations.

Omnicare (NYSE: OCR) blamed lower reimbursement rates for a drop in third quarter earnings.

Third quarter earnings fell for Lincoln Financial (NYSE: LNC) due to lower sales of fixed rate annuities.

In the broad market, advancing issues outpaced decliners by a margin of more than 2 to 1 on the NYSE and by a margin of 9 to 7 on Nasdaq. The Russell 2000 which tracks small cap stocks added 4 points to 820.
